My cousin sent me some of these delicious nutty buttercreams, and I've been making them ever since. It's a wonderful gift recipe since one batch yields seven dozen. Ingredients:
1 cup butter, softened |
7-1/2 cups confectioners' sugar |
2 tablespoons half-and-half cream |
1 teaspoon vanilla extract |
3 cups milk chocolate chips |
2 teaspoons shortening |
2-1/2 cups finely chopped peanuts |
Directions:
1. In a large bowl, cream the butter until light and fluffy. Gradually add confectioners' sugar, cream and vanilla; beat on medium speed for 3-4 minutes. Shape into 3/4-in. balls. 2. In a microwave or heavy saucepan, melt chocolate chips and shortening; stir until smooth. Dip balls in melted chocolate; roll in peanuts. Place on waxed paper-lined baking sheets; refrigerate until set.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ator. Yield: about 7 dozen. |
